## Changed defaults — Thornbeck firmware channel

Starting with agent 7.1, devices enroll on the "steady" update channel instead of "rapid." Rollout windows default to overnight local time, and staged rollouts pause automatically on elevated failure rates. Support: customers reporting delayed updates are likely seeing the new defaults, not a fault. For reference, the shipped defaults are listed below.

service settings:
PRAIX_LOG_LEVEL=error
PRAIX_METRICS_HOST=metrics.praix.qorvelcorp.corp
PRAIX_POOL_SIZE=16

## Who owns cache invalidation?

Fair warning: the catalog cache in Shopwick is the part of the codebase most likely to bite you. Product edits fan out invalidation events to three regional caches, and if you touch the TTL logic or the event fan-out, expect stale-price bugs to surface a week later. Reviewers, please be picky here — demand a test for every invalidation path. Questions, escalations, and final review calls all go to the owner below.

named custodian: Brivan Eliath Quenox Frador

## 2.4.0

Renamed: GRAPHVIZOR_PLUGIN_SECRET is now DEPMAP_PLUGIN_SECRET, matching the Depmap rename. Plugin authors must update env files before 2.5.0; the old name is ignored as of this release. No other behavioral changes to the graph rendering API. Manifests referencing the old key will fail validation. Set the new entry in your plugin's env file on the line that follows.

env line for tawig-kadup: VAULT_KEY5=07c4f